Chlorobenzene (abbreviated PhCl) is an aryl chloride and the simplest of the chlorobenzenes, consisting of a benzene ring substituted with one chlorine atom. Its chemical formula is C 6 H 5 Cl. This colorless, flammable liquid is a common solvent and a widely used intermediate in the manufacture of other chemicals.

DCDPS is synthesized via sulfonation of chlorobenzene with sulfuric acid, often in the presence of various additives to optimize the formation of the 4,4′-isomer: ClC 6 H 5 + SO 3 → (ClC 6 H 4) 2 SO 2 + H 2 O. It can also be produced by chlorination of diphenylsulfone. [3]

Hexachlorobenzene, or perchlorobenzene, is an aryl chloride and a six-substituted chlorobenzene with the molecular formula C 6 Cl 6. It is a fungicide formerly used as a seed treatment, especially on wheat to control the fungal disease bunt. Its use has been banned globally under the Stockholm Convention on Persistent Organic Pollutants. [6]
4,4’-Dichlorobenzophenone is prepared by the acylation of chlorobenzene with 4-chlorobenzoyl chloride. The conversion is typically conducted in the presence of an aluminium chloride catalyst in a petroleum ether solvent. ClC 6 H 5 C(O)Cl + C 6 H 5 Cl → (ClC 6 H 4) 2 CO + HCl
